Couple of queries.
Torpedoes hit in the end phase and damage control is done in the end phase. Which one is done first?

When a ship gets crippled you lose traits, turrets etc, it does not look as though it clearly deals with how you roll for torpedoes if you have them? Is it 4+ to destroy or not?

Not a query just an observation, Has anyone else considered adding additional AD's to either destroyers or cruisers? Destroyers have almost no useful guns at all and even 8 inch cruisers have a teeny tiny little punch?

My simple suggestion would be everything listed as 1AD becomes 2AD. Bit simple but just my 2p.

I'd say torpedoes first.

Currently there's no way you can lose torpedoes through damage.
 
In our first game we misread "Special Traits" for "Special Weapons", and were rolling to see if a Crippled ship lost their Torpedoes when crippled like you do the Traits. Most did, some didn't: may not have been the way it was intended, but it seemed to work.

I'd definitely go with the previously-suggested idea of substituting "Torpedoes" for "Turret" on the Critical Hit chart for ships with torps but without main turrets (like DD's).

If you read through the entire End Phase sequence it seems logical that damage (and possible Crits) from incoming Torpedoes would be resolved first, then conduct Damage Control to try and offset the effects.
 
In general I'd support a 4+ roll for the torpedo systems, same as for turrets, when the ship is crippled.
